Some specialist children's book stores and local libraries offer book readings and storytelling sessions for preschool children. Sessions are usually interactive and give children a great opportunity to hear different books in a group setting.
Many of these sessions are free of charge, some require pre-bookings in order to keep groups numbers to a manageable size.
Public Libraries - many public libraries run regular storytelling sessions during school term times. We haven't included specific details here as they can be changeable, however, this information is generally available via your local library website or by contacting your local library directly.
